Why Knowing Your Tank's Litre Capacity Matters
Before diving into the mathematics, it deserves comprehending why accurate water volume is so important. An Aquarium Pump Calculator is a closed ecosystem, and maintaining chemical balance is vital.
- Medication Dosing: Overdosing can toxin fish, while underdosing leaves diseases without treatment. Nearly all aquarium medications need exact measurements based on litres.
- Water Treatments: Dechlorinators, fertilizers, and pH adjusters need to be added in precise percentages to the volume of water being treated.
- Stocking Limits: The traditional guideline of thumb-- such as one centimetre of fish per litre of water-- depends totally on understanding the real water volume.
- Filtering Requirements: Filters are rated by the volume of water they can process per hour. Knowing the tank size makes sure adequate filtering.
Fundamental Formulas for Standard Tank Shapes
The technique used to compute litres depends on the shape of the aquarium. A lot of tanks fall under a few standard geometric categories.
To make computations easy, the universal conversion aspect to bear in mind is:1 cubic centimetre (₤ cm ^ 3 ₤) = 0.001 litres (or 1,000 cubic centimetres = 1 litre).
Additionally, when determining in centimetres, the basic formula for rectangle-shaped tanks is:₤ ₤ text Volume in Litres = frac text Length (cm) times text Width (cm) times text Height (cm) 1,000 ₤ ₤
1. Rectangular Aquariums
Rectangle-shaped tanks are the most common type found in homes. To discover the volume, determine the interior length, width, and height in centimetres.
- Formula: ₤ text Length times text Width times text Height/ 1,000 ₤
- Example: A tank measuring 100 cm long, 40 cm large, and 50 cm high:₤ ₤ frac 100 times 40 times 50 1,000 = frac 200,000 1,000 = 200 text Litres ₤ ₤
2. Cylindrical (Round) Aquariums
Round tanks need a slightly various formula because of their circular base, relying on pi (₤ pi approx 3.1416 ₤).
- Formula: ₤ pi times text Radius ^ 2 times text Height/ 1,000 ₤ ( Note: Radius is half of the size).
- Example: A cylinder with a diameter of 50 cm (Radius = 25 cm) and a height of 60 cm:₤ ₤ 3.1416 times 25 ^ 2 times 60/ 1,000 = 3.1416 times 625 times 60/ 1,000 = 117.8 text Litres ₤ ₤
3. Bow-Front Aquariums
Bow-front tanks feature a curved front glass that broadens the viewing location. Because calculating the specific volume of the bow can be intricate, aquarists normally use a modified rectangle-shaped formula.
- Method: Measure the width from the side (at the narrowest point) and the width at the widest point of the bow. Average the 2 widths together, then deal with the tank as a basic rectangle.

Accounting for Displacement: The Hidden Factor
One common mistake beginners make is presuming that a 200-litre tank holds 200 litres of water. In reality, it holds less. This discrepancy is because of displacement.
Every object put inside the aquarium pushes water out of the method. Therefore, the actual water volume is lower than the calculated glass volume. Factors that reduce overall water volume consist of:
- Substrate: Gravel, sand, or aqusoil layers take up significant area at the bottom of the tank.
- Hardscape: Large driftwood pieces, rocks, and slate developments displace water.
- Decorations: Artificial accessories, caves, and background structures minimize capacity.
- Equipment: Internal filters, heating systems, and air stones take in small quantities of area.
- Unfilled Space: Most tanks are not filled right to the really leading; water sits a centimetre or two below the plastic rim.
How to Estimate Displacement
While calculating the precise displacement of every rock and pebble is tiresome, aquarists can generally estimate that designs, substrate, and void reduce overall tank volume by approximately 10% to 15%.
For instance, a tank computed geometrically to hold 200 litres will likely hold closer to 175 to 180 litres of actual water when completely embellished. When dosing potent medications, it is always more secure to compute based upon this slightly reduced water volume to avoid unintentional overdosing.
Step-by-Step Guide: How to Calculate Your Tank's Volume
Follow these basic steps to find the real water capacity of any basic Aquarium Weight Calculator:
- Measure the Interior: Use a measuring tape to find the within length, width, and height of the glass. Determining the inside avoids factoring in the density of the glass walls.
- Transform Units: Ensure all measurements remain in centimetres.
- Apply the Formula: Multiply Length ₤ times ₤ Width ₤ times ₤ Height, then divide the resulting number by 1,000 to get litres.
- Deduct for Substrate and Decor: Estimate the space used up by gravel and rocks, and subtract roughly 10% from the final number to discover the actual water volume.
- Alternative Method (The Bucket Test): For irregularly shaped or custom-made tanks, the most accurate method to discover volume is to fill the tank using a container of a recognized size (such as a 10-litre bucket) and keep a tally of the number of containers it takes to fill the aquarium.
